Nolan finished his NHL career with the Toronto Maple Leafs (2003-04), Phoenix Coyotes (2006-07), Calgary Flames (2007-08), and Minnesota Wild (2008-10). He played in 29 games for ZSC Lions of Switzerland's National League A in 2010-11. Nolan announced his retirement on February 7, 2012. He is currently a co-owner of 2 restaurants in San Jose.

The Sharks traded Jeff Friesen to the Mighty Ducks of Anaheim in 2000-01, where he played until the end of the 2001-02 season. He played for the New Jersey Devils (2002-04), Washington Capitals (2005-06), Mighty Ducks (2006), Calgary Flames (2006-07), Lake Erie Monsters of AHL (5 games in 2008), and Eisbaren Berlin of Germany's Deutsche Eishockey Liga (2009-11).
